Dokument

Natychmiastowe (e.sol. bez DOMCContentLoaded) JS nie działa

Natychmiastowe (e.sol. bez DOMCContentLoaded) JS nie działa
  1. Czy musisz używać DOMContentLoaded??
  2. Czy DOMContentLoaded czeka na skrypty??
  3. Czym jest dokument addEventListener (' DOMContentLoaded?
  4. Jak mogę zaimplementować własny dokument $( .gotowa funkcjonalność bez użycia jQuery?
  5. Skąd mam wiedzieć, czy mój Dom jest gotowy??
  6. Co to jest front-end Dom?
  7. Czy DOMContentLoaded czeka na CSS??
  8. Jak uruchomić skrypt przed załadowaniem strony??
  9. Jak sprawić, by JS czekał, aż Dom zostanie zaktualizowany??
  10. Jak korzystać z dokumentu onload?
  11. Czy ładuje zdarzenie DOM?
  12. Jak działa ładowanie okna??

Czy musisz używać DOMContentLoaded??

Zasadniczo nie. Jeśli skrypt modyfikuje element, musi on istnieć. ... Jeśli umieścisz go wcześniej, nie istnieje i możesz użyć DOMContentLoaded, aby poczekać na wykonanie skryptu, aż upewnisz się, że istnieje.

Czy DOMContentLoaded czeka na skrypty??

DOMContentLoaded i skrypty

Gdy przeglądarka przetwarza dokument HTML i natrafia na <scenariusz> tag, musi zostać wykonany przed kontynuowaniem budowania DOM. To środek ostrożności, ponieważ skrypty mogą chcieć modyfikować DOM, a nawet dokumentować. napisz do niego, więc DOMContentLoaded musi poczekać.

Czym jest dokument addEventListener (' DOMContentLoaded?

Zdarzenie DOMContentLoaded jest uruchamiane, gdy początkowy dokument HTML zostanie całkowicie załadowany i przeanalizowany, bez oczekiwania na zakończenie ładowania arkuszy stylów, obrazów i ramek podrzędnych. Synchroniczny JavaScript wstrzymuje parsowanie DOM. ...

Jak mogę zaimplementować własny dokument $( .gotowa funkcjonalność bez użycia jQuery?

dokument. addEventListener('DOMContentLoaded', function() konsola. log('dokument jest gotowy.
...
Trzy opcje:

  1. Jeśli skrypt jest ostatnim tagiem ciała, DOM będzie gotowy przed wykonaniem tagu skryptu.
  2. Gdy DOM będzie gotowy, „readyState” zmieni się na „complete”
  3. Umieść wszystko w detektorze zdarzeń „DOMContentLoaded”.

Skąd mam wiedzieć, czy mój Dom jest gotowy??

W wielu przeglądarkach można sprawdzić, czy dokument został załadowany w czystym JavaScript, używając readyState .

  1. jeśli (dokument. readyState === 'complete') // Strona jest w pełni załadowana ...
  2. let stateCheck = setInterval(() => jeśli (dokument. readyState === 'kompletne') clearInterval(stateCheck); // dokument gotowy , 100); ...
  3. dokument.

Co to jest front-end Dom?

Document Object Model (DOM) to interfejs programistyczny dla dokumentów HTML i XML. Reprezentuje stronę, dzięki czemu programy mogą zmieniać strukturę, styl i zawartość dokumentu. DOM reprezentuje dokument jako węzły i obiekty. W ten sposób języki programowania mogą łączyć się ze stroną. Strona internetowa to dokument.

Czy DOMContentLoaded czeka na CSS??

DOMContentLoaded nie czeka na załadowanie arkuszy stylów, pod warunkiem, że po odwołaniu do arkusza stylów nie zostaną umieszczone żadne skrypty, <link rel="arkusz stylów"> . Dotyczy to wszystkich przeglądarek obsługujących DOMContentLoaded.

Jak uruchomić skrypt przed załadowaniem strony??

dantel: Zamiast umieszczać swój javascript tuż nad </ciało> możesz użyć metody onload obiektu window, aby uruchomić kod js po załadowaniu okna.

Jak sprawić, by JS czekał, aż Dom zostanie zaktualizowany??

ustaw go na przetwarzanie, a następnie wykonaj setTimeout, aby zapobiec uruchamianiu zadania intensywnie korzystającego z procesora, dopóki div nie zostanie zaktualizowany. możesz zmodyfikować opóźnienie setTimeout w razie potrzeby, może być ono większe dla wolniejszych komputerów/przeglądarek. Edytuj: Możesz również użyć alertu lub okna dialogowego potwierdzenia, aby pozwolić stronie na aktualizację.

Jak korzystać z dokumentu onload?

onload uruchamia się dwukrotnie, gdy jest zadeklarowany wewnątrz <ciało> , raz po zadeklarowaniu wewnątrz <głowa> (gdzie zdarzenie działa wtedy jako dokument. ładuje ). liczenie i działanie zależne od stanu licznika pozwala na emulację obu zachowań zdarzeń. Alternatywnie zadeklaruj okno.

Czy ładuje zdarzenie DOM?

Zdarzenie load jest uruchamiane po załadowaniu całej strony, w tym wszystkich zależnych zasobów, takich jak arkusze stylów i obrazy. Jest to w przeciwieństwie do DOMContentLoaded , który jest uruchamiany, gdy tylko strona DOM zostanie załadowana, bez oczekiwania na zakończenie ładowania zasobów.

Jak działa ładowanie okna??

Zdarzenie onload występuje, gdy obiekt został załadowany. onload jest najczęściej używany w ramach <ciało> element do wykonania skryptu, gdy strona internetowa całkowicie załaduje całą zawartość (w tym obrazy, pliki skryptów, pliki CSS itp.).).

Permalink zmienia się po kilku minutach od zapisania posta
Co się stanie, jeśli zmienię strukturę permalinka?? Jak zmienić permalink posta?? Jak naprawić permalinki w WordPressie?? Czy możesz zmienić permalink...
W poście na blogu mam wyświetlane kategorie, czy istnieje sposób na wykluczenie kategorii, takiej jak „Media”?
Jak wykluczyć kategorie ze strony bloga?? Jak wykluczyć kategorie z bloga WordPress?? Jak ukryć określoną kategorię przed postem?? Jak wyświetlić tylk...
Pokaż nazwę kategorii w adresie URL posta tylko dla określonych kategorii
Jak wyświetlać nazwy kategorii w postach WordPress?? Jak znaleźć kategorię adresu URL?? Jak uzyskać nazwę kategorii w adresie URL WordPress?? Jak wyśw...